The dangers of the “Greater Israel” project for the region.
Hassan Hardan wrote in his analytical article in the Lebanese newspaper Al-Bina: The recent statements of the Israeli Prime Minister regarding his expansionist ambitions to realize the project called “Greater Israel” point to dangerous points about the true nature of the Zionist plan in the region.
From these statements by Netanyahu, it can be predicted that the region will experience greater insecurity and instability and intensify the conflict.
On the other hand, these statements indicate the revival of a Zionist expansionist concept that raises serious concerns among the Palestinian people, Arab countries, and the international community.
Netanyahu’s statements indicate his insistence on the ideology called “Greater Israel” that includes beyond the borders of occupied Palestine. This ideology, which has been welcomed by the extreme right wing in the Zionist regime, includes the annexation of the remaining occupied Palestinian territories as well as parts of neighboring Arab countries such as Jordan, Syria, Egypt, Lebanon, Iraq, and Saudi Arabia.
The analysis continues: These statements are a re-emphasis of the Zionist regime on its opposition to the formation of a Palestinian state, and by making these statements, Netanyahu tried to strengthen his political base among the far-right movement within the regime and to satisfy his partners in his cabinet coalition who strongly believe in this ideology.
With these statements, Netanyahu also sent a message to the international community that he does not pay attention to international pressure and is determined to realize his project even at the expense of regional security and stability.
Intensification of tension and conflict in the region and increased cycles of violence should be considered among the expected consequences of such statements.
According to this analysis, expansionist measures and annexation of the occupied territories will lead the Palestinians to intensify resistance, because this is their only option to confront the Zionist occupation and expansionism.
